Cons

  • The EZ Change chuck system is not compatible with older Dremel models and may be difficult to operate initially
  • Changing collets can be tricky; requires needle nose pliers, and only one collet (3/32") is included in the kit
  • Additional collets are sold separately and can be costly, with some priced at $16.09 each
  • Metal cutoff wheels are expensive, increasing overall project costs
  • Some users found the included instructions vague, needing more detailed guidance on accessory use
  • The kit may feel overpriced, especially if you already own compatible tools and accessories, as some find it unworthy for the price
  • Limited to small jobs and detailed work; not suited for heavuty or prolonged use
  • The lack of a shaft lock and difficulties in swapping bits might be frustrating for some users
  • Compatibility issues with certain accessories like right angle heads or cable attachments are possible

Bottom Line

The Dremel 4200-6/40 offers a high-performance, versatile rotary tool with the convenience of EZ Change and a large accessory kit, making it a solid choice for detailed and light-to-moderate tasks. However, its price point and some compatibility and usability quirks mean that if you already own older Dremel models or need a tool for heavy-duty work, you might want to explore other options. For those seeking maximum ease of use and broad accessory compatibility, this model is worth considering, but be mindful of additional costs for accessories and collets.
